Meaning ❉ Bambara Groundnut, a modest leguminous crop historically significant across West Africa, serves as a gentle, internal support for the vibrant structure of textured hair. This unassuming seed, when considered for foundational understanding of hair growth, offers a plant-based abundance of proteins and vital micronutrients like iron and zinc, which are crucial for maintaining healthy follicular activity and encouraging strong strand formation.
